News Corp. Acquires Rest of Jamba From Verisign for $200M

Authored by Mark Hefflinger on October 7, 2008 - 7:52am.

New York - News Corporation (NYSE: NWS) announced on Tuesday that it has acquired the rest of mobile entertainment firm Jamba from joint venture partner Verisign (NASD: VRSN) for about $200 million.

News Corp. previously acquired a controlling interest in the company -- known as Jamster in English-speaking countries -- in 2007, and combined it with its Fox Mobile Entertainment unit.

"This sale is an important step in our effort to focus on our core businesses in Internet infrastructure," said VeriSign chairman, president and CEO Jim Bidzos.

"News Corp. has been a good business partner and we wish them well as they continue to operate an exciting mobile entertainment business."
